A new act of indiscipline in the Chilean National Team would have occurred in the middle of the Copa América 2021 that is played in Brazil. It seems that the good start to the tournament with a draw against Argentina and a victory against Bolivia, raised the spirits in the Chilean national team, which would have organized a party at their concentration hotel in the previous duel against Uruguay, this Monday for the third date of the continental tournament.

According to information provided by the Chilean portal ‘Rumbo a Primera Chile’, six selected from the cast led by Martín Lasarte “would be involved with parties and women at the hotel,” said the aforementioned media. In addition, always according to the information on the website, "the coaching staff headed by Martín Lasarte would have the intention to present his resignation", in a press conference announced by the National Team to present its position regarding what happened in the squad.

"A conference will be held to clarify their situation, in addition to saying that last night they would have bought six return tickets," adds the information, taking into account a National Team that did not train last Saturday and will only do so this Sunday afternoon, increasing plus the uncertainty about the team. The truth is that, if such passages really exist, their owners have a first and last name. Of these, only 5 were established, although it is feared that they may become more than those currently being counted. With Arturo Vidal as a star figure, and a more sensitive drop thinking about the tournament, Gary Medel, Charles Aránguiz, Eduardo Vargas and Guillermo Maripán would run the same fate.

Chile will face Uruguay this Monday for date 3 of Group A of the Copa América 2021, at the Arena Pantanal stadium in the city of Cuiabá. The last time that Chile and Uruguay saw each other was on Date 1 of the Qatar 2022 Qualifiers. In that duel, Maestro Tabárez's team won 2-1 against the then-selected team led by Reinaldo Rueda, current DT of Colombia. Chile is on track and one step away from qualifying for the next instance. ‘La Roja’ equalized against Argentina in the opening of Group A, and then added three points against Bolivia, which they defeated 1-0 with the scorer debut of Anglo-Chilean Ben Brerenton.
